Abstract
A duty cycle correction circuit includes a duty correction circuit, an information generation circuit and a duty control circuit. The duty correction circuit corrects a duty rate of an input clock signal based on a duty control code to generate an output clock signal. The information generation circuit compares a difference between operation power voltages based on an operation mode to generate voltage information. The duty control circuit receives the voltage information from the information generation circuit and generates the duty control code that includes the voltage information based on a duty rate of the output clock signal.
